Lawyer who filed impeachment against Sereno seeks Senate seat
October 12, 2018
The lawyer who filed an impeachment complaint against Chief Justice Maria Lourdes Sereno filed his Certificate of Candidacy (COC) for senator Friday afternoon, but used the wrong form.
The Commission on Elections ( Comelec) Secretariat said Larry Gadon asked the Commission on Elections ( Comelec) if he is using an old form. The Comelec said yes and it took him an hour to accomplish it.
But in his speech, Gadon denied using a wrong COC. “I asked the Comelec if it is the wrong form before I filled it up. It was not accomplished yet,” said Gadon.
Gadon, who is known for using strong words against some members of the Senate when he filed the impeachment against Sereno at the House of Representatives, said in a TV interview he does not see it as a problem.
Before filing his COC, Gadon expressed confidence he would win.
"Filipinos will vote for me because I am not a fool and they will vote for me because they are fools," said Gadon.
Gadon's impeachment complaint did not prosper as Sereno was ousted due to a quo warrantuo petition by Solicitor General Jose Calida Jr before the Supreme Court. DMS
